The Puke Factor
Should we, in a moment of utter foolishness (not that any self-respecting cat would!), indulge in this ill-fated snack, the consequences could be dire. Expect a rapid expulsion of lunch, complete with an orchestra of gurgles and perhaps some melodramatic retching. You might also witness excessive drooling and a general air of feline discontent.
